Transaction 4b2ddb85660821675576fab6007a371cdbb92e12d6b647fffe387b4e3e62346a
1 Input
2 Outputs
- 4b2ddb85660821675576fab6007a371cdbb92e12d6b647fffe387b4e3e62346a:0
- 4b2ddb85660821675576fab6007a371cdbb92e12d6b647fffe387b4e3e62346a:1
value 1527356
address 1PuphmhyxpN1v3hT8GyxGa7GmNm4wZ873e
value 12839
address 14HtSeZedNvATQmDLTKSbtcF118s2Lko7V